In general, markers are picked by analyzing prior exploration done. Identification markers which can be selected ought to provide a constructive end result for just one type of cell. one particular percentage of the chromosome that's a place of aim when conducting DNA methylation are tissue-precise differentially methylated locations, T-DMRs. The degree of methylation for your T-DMRs ranges dependant upon the system fluid.[125] A study crew designed a marker technique that is certainly two-fold. the 1st marker is methylated only while in the goal fluid while the 2nd is methylated in the rest of the fluids.[108] As an example, if venous blood marker A is un-methylated and venous blood marker B is methylated in the fluid, it signifies the presence of only venous blood. In contrast, if venous blood marker A is methylated and venous blood marker B is un-methylated in a few fluid, then that signifies venous blood is in a mix of fluids. Some examples for DNA methylation markers are Mens1(menstrual blood), Spei1(saliva), and Sperm2(seminal fluid).

important progress continues to be produced in understanding DNA methylation while in the model plant Arabidopsis thaliana. DNA methylation in vegetation differs from that of mammals: though DNA methylation in mammals mostly takes place to the cytosine nucleotide in a very CpG website, in crops the cytosine is often methylated at CpG, CpHpG, and CpHpH internet sites, where by H represents any nucleotide but not guanine.

Epigenetic modifications for instance DNA methylation happen to be implicated in heart problems, such as atherosclerosis. In animal products of atherosclerosis, vascular tissue, and also blood cells such as mononuclear blood cells, show global hypomethylation with gene-certain areas of hypermethylation.
